That statement is false

.

Desalination refers to the process of removing a mineral and salt content from a certain substance using modern technology.

This technique is commonly used in the process of transforming sea water into a drinkable water. During desalination, many plants or animals in the area could died because they unable to obtain necessary nutrient to continue on living.
